Application of vacuum bag method in safety glass manufacturing

[China Glass Net] Vacuum bag forming process is a new type of composite material forming process, which has the advantages of simple operation, stable product quality and high production efficiency. It is widely used in aerospace, shipbuilding, high-speed trains, sporting goods, wind blades and other fields. .

Laminated glass, also known as laminated glass, is made up of two or more layers of glass, as the name suggests. It is safe because there is one or more layers of film between the glass. When the glass is broken by impact, the fragments are stuck by the film, and only radial cracks are formed, which will not cause personal injury or death due to debris scattering. It is mainly used in automobiles, ships, airplanes, trains and high-rise buildings. By changing the properties of the film and the combined structure, it can produce laminated glass with various functions, such as bulletproof glass, electrochromic glass, electromagnetic shielding glass, fireproof glass, antenna glass, electric heating glass, anti-theft alarm glass, and transition color laminated glass. UV laminated glass, etc.

The production method of the laminated glass includes two methods of film hot pressing and grouting. At present, most of the film hot pressing method adopts a silicone rubber ring, which is referred to as a silicon ring method. The silicone rubber ring is made of methyl vinyl silicone rubber raw rubber added to the double-roll rubber mixer or the closed kneading machine. After gradually adding carbon black and other additives, the dough is extruded and the profiled rubber strip is extruded by the extruder. , made by bonding and other processing methods. The process of producing laminated glass by the silicon ring method is as follows: firstly, a silicon ring with a slightly smaller product size is fabricated, PVB film is placed between the two layers of glass, the silicon ring is placed on the edge of the glass of the interlayer film, and the silicon ring is vacuumed. The preheat treatment is carried out in an oven, and then heated and pressurized in an autoclave to obtain a laminated glass product. The advantages of the production of laminated glass by the silicon ring method are: easy and fast operation, and the silicon ring can be reused. At the same time, there are disadvantages: the edge of the laminated glass is often bubbled, the quality of the product is not stable enough; the silicon ring is expensive, and different sizes of laminated glass need to be customized with different silicon rings.

Compared with the silicon ring method, the vacuum bag method is used to manufacture the laminated glass, which can significantly reduce the content of bubbles or defects of the product; improve the transparency of the laminated glass; and the product quality is stable and the yield is high. The operating principle of the laminated glass by vacuum bag method is as follows: the flat glass and the film are sealed by a vacuum bag, vacuumed, and then heated, the film is slowly melted, and the gas wrapped between the flat glass passes through the perforated release film to enter the airfelt. Afterwards, it is removed by the vacuum valve, so that the flat glass is tightly bonded together. The vacuum sealing method of laminated glass is shown in Fig. 1. The operation steps of producing laminated glass by vacuum bag method are as follows: (1) placing a flat glass on a horizontal mold; (2) laying a plurality of layers of EVA film on the flat glass; (3) placing another flat glass; (4) The stripping film covers the end surface, fixes the position with pressure-sensitive adhesive tape, and coats the air-proof felt at the corners of the flat glass to prevent the vacuum bag from being punctured; (5) Covering the flat glass with a vacuum bag and vacuuming the bag with a sealing strip (6) Install the vacuum valve, use the quick connector to connect the vacuum tube; (7) vacuum; (8) heat to 160-170 ° C in the oven, keep warm; (9) cool down to room temperature, remove the laminated glass out of the oven; 10) Remove the release film, airfelt, vacuum bag; (11) Place the laminated glass in the autoclave, heat and pressurize, press the laminated glass to the required thickness; the purpose of using the release film in the manufacturing process: 1 Prevent the film from being melted and adhered to the vacuum bag to avoid partial tearing of the film when demolding, improve the appearance of the product, and facilitate demolding; 2 the film can be overflowed after being melted, but the amount of overflow is not excessive, and the edge of the glass is kept. Flat .
